Creating baby names with AI

·
2 April 2025
·
28  mins read

If there’s one thing that keeps expectant parents up at night, it’s choosing the perfect name for their little one. After all, this linguistic gift will follow your child from playground to boardroom, setting the tone for introductions throughout their life.

In Chinese culture, a good name is believed to shape destiny. In the West, it’s often about honouring family or sounding pleasing. But across cultures, the weight of naming a child feels universal—perhaps because 80% of parents report feeling significant pressure to choose the “perfect” name. This pressure doubles when navigating the complexities of Chinese naming traditions, where each stroke of the brush carries centuries of cultural significance.

As someone who straddles both Chinese and Western cultures, I’ve always been fascinated by how names and often go on deep dives when naming characters in my writing. However, this is nothing like I’ve experienced—creating a name for my own child. My wife and I had been navigating the particularly complex world of Chinese naming since her second trimester. And like any modern problem solver with a penchant for technology, I wondered: could AI help streamline this deeply personal process?

The art and science of Chinese names

For the uninitiated, a Chinese name isn’t just a collection of pretty characters. It’s a carefully balanced equation taking into account the stroke count numerology, characters’ elemental harmony, phonetic flow, and layers of cultural meaning that would make an onion jealous.

Traditional methods involve consulting fortune tellers, studying almanacs, and sometimes paying naming specialists who consider everything from birth charts to family histories. My parents’ generation would have never imagined using artificial intelligence to name their offspring—they were more likely to consult the year’s “Yellow Calendar” (《黄历》 Huánglì) and our family’s genealogy records.

But here we are in 2025, and AI tools have become sophisticated enough to understand these cultural nuances and assist in creating meaningful names—though with human guidance, of course. Think of it as having a culturally knowledgeable assistant rather than outsourcing the entire emotional process.

I recognise that some traditionalists might raise eyebrows at using AI for something as sacred as naming. After all, isn’t this precisely the kind of deeply human, cultural practice that should remain untouched by technology?

I had similar reservations initially. However, I came to see AI not as replacing tradition but as a tool for exploring it more thoroughly. The combination of my cultural knowledge with AI’s analytical capabilities allowed us to honour traditions with greater depth than either approach alone could achieve.

Our AI-assisted naming methodology

Working with AI on baby naming is a bit like having a master chef help you prepare a family recipe. The chef brings technical expertise and an understanding of flavour combinations, but you still provide the family’s secret ingredients and make the final decisions about taste. Similarly, AI offered analytical precision while we supplied the cultural context and emotional resonance.

I developed a comprehensive approach combining traditional wisdom with AI assistance.

1. Set constraints

First, we put down details like the expected birth year, my wife’s and my names, our respective bazi—our time of births—for the AI to use as reference, along with other constraints to maintain cultural integrity while making sure it won’t be awkward internationally.

The baby’s expected zodiac would play a part in the naming because the zodiac carries its own element. I went into the naming process with a Dragon year baby in mind, since our due date was a few days into Chinese New Year and we expected the baby to arrive a week or two early.

  • Zodiac
  • Bazi
    • Parents’ bazi derived from the time of birth
    • Since we didn’t know the baby’s bazi yet, we checked against it later on
  • Parents’ name
    • The stroke counts in the parents’ names
    • The elemental profiles of the parents’ names
    • The meaning of the parents’ name
  • Family surname
    • Our baby would take my family name 萧 (Xiāo)
  • Things to avoid
    • Check against historical figures with the same or same-sounding name
    • Verify that there are no taboos in regional expression in China and Southeast Asia
    • Ensure there are no potential negative connotations

With this information, the AI was able to narrow down:

  • The ideal range of stroke counts, in our case a target of 25–35 total strokes
  • The ideal element of suggested characters
    • Prioritising Wood element to support the Wood Dragon year
    • Balancing Water to counter excessive Fire in parents’ names
  • The preferred phonetics

2. Generate names

I got the Claude to generate lists of names that fit the above constraints and are auspicious based on the input we gave. I went through over a hundred names. For each, the AI provided detailed analysis of:

  • The total stroke count and rate how auspicious it was
  • Element of each character and evaluate the elemental balance
  • Visual balance between the characters
  • Explain the name’s meaning and how it fits with the meaning of the parents’ names
  • Checking the tonal progression so that the name flows well when spoken
  • Note if the name is more masculine, feminine or neutral, since we don’t know the baby’s gender in China until birth

3. Generate from shortlist

With our initial shortlist of names, I had a list of names that worked, so I figured it was useful to feed the list back to the AI as reference to generate more names. It did so by reusing certain characters that we liked, or meanings that we thought were good as the starting point to come up with further ideas.

Prompt used

Here’s the prompt I used:

Create and analyse Chinese baby names. Use the following information and templates to guide your suggestions:

## BASIC INFORMATION:## PERSONAL INFORMATION:
- Family surname: [your surname in Chinese characters and pinyin]
- Baby's expected birth year and zodiac: [e.g. 2024 Wood Dragon]
- Baby's gender (if known): [boy/girl/unknown]
- Father's name: [Chinese characters and pinyin]
- Father's birth year and zodiac: [e.g. 1990 Metal Horse]
- Mother's name: [Chinese characters and pinyin]
- Mother's birth year and zodiac: [e.g. 1993 Water Rooster]

## NAMING REQUIREMENTS:
1. Elemental Balance:
   - Support element for the birth year: [e.g. 2024]
   - Harmonize with parents' elements
   - Balance any excessive elements in family
   
2. Structural Requirements:
   - Ensure that the name has a total stroke count that falls within the range that is the most auspicious
   - Number of characters in given name: [usually 1-2]
   - Any specific characters to include/avoid: [if applicable]
   
3. Phonetic Considerations:
   - Preferred tone patterns: [if any]
   - Important sounds or syllables: [if any]
   - Ensure that the name is easy to pronounce internationally
   
4. Meaning Requirements:
   - Desired qualities or themes: [e.g. wisdom, strength, grace]
   - Cultural or literary references preferred: [if any]
   
5. Additional Considerations:
   - Family naming traditions to respect: [if any]
   - Cultural background specifics: [e.g. Malaysian Chinese Hakka family]
   - Any other important factors: [e.g. religious considerations]

## ANALYSIS TEMPLATE:
For each suggested name, please provide a comprehensive analysis using this structure:

1. Basic Information
   - Characters: [Name in Chinese]
   - Pinyin: [with tones marked]
   - Meaning: [individual character meanings + combined meaning]

2. Structural Analysis
   - Stroke Count:
     - Surname: [number] strokes
     - Middle character: [number] strokes
     - Last character: [number] strokes
     - Given name total: [number] strokes + auspiciousness rating
     - Full name total: [number] strokes + auspiciousness rating

3. Elemental Balance
   - Surname character: [element]
   - Middle character: [element] + any secondary influences
   - Last character: [element] + any secondary influences
   - Overall: How these elements interact with each other and birth year
   - Bazi flexibility assessment: How well it balances family elements

4. Phonetic Analysis
   - Tone progression: [tone numbers, e.g. 1-3-4]
   - Flow assessment: How well the sounds transition
   - Dialectal considerations: How it sounds in relevant dialects
   - Potential pronunciation issues: Any challenges for native/non-native speakers

5. Cultural Safety Check
   - Historical figure conflicts: Any notable historical namesakes
   - Modern figure conflicts: Any contemporary namesakes to be aware of
   - Regional meaning checks: Any problematic meanings in specific regions
   - Dialect meaning checks: Any issues when pronounced in other dialects
   - Homonym analysis: Any sound-alike words with negative connotations

6. Meaning Depth
   - Individual character significance: Deeper meaning of each character
   - Combined imagery: The visual or conceptual image created
   - Literary references: Connections to classical texts or poetry
   - Cultural connotations: Broader cultural associations
   - Gender appropriateness: How suitable for the intended gender

7. Name Flexibility
   - Formal/informal usage: How it works in different contexts
   - International considerations: How it translates globally
   - Nickname potential: Natural shortening options
   - Writing style variations: How it appears in different calligraphy styles

8. Overall Assessment
   - Strengths: [Key positive attributes]
   - Concerns: [Potential issues or drawbacks]
   - Recommendation Rating: [Scale 1-10]

Example analysis

To illustrate how this works in practice, here’s an actual analysis for one of our shortlisted names, 萧旭霖 (Xiāo Xùlín):

*### Example Analysis: 萧旭霖 (Xiāo Xù Lín)

**1. Basic Information:**
- Characters: 萧旭霖
- Pinyin: Xiāo Xù Lín
- Meaning: "Rising sun abundance" or "Dawn's blessing"

**2. Structural Analysis:**
- Stroke Count:
  - Surname (萧): 12 strokes
  - Middle character (旭): 6 strokes
  - Last character (霖): 16 strokes
  - Given name total: 22 strokes - Moderately auspicious
  - Full name total: 34 strokes - Highly auspicious

**3. Elemental Balance:**
- Character 1 (萧): Metal
- Character 2 (旭): Fire (sunrise)
- Character 3 (霖): Water (strong Water element)
- Overall: Excellent dynamic balance with Metal (surname), Fire and Water (given name)
- Bazi flexibility: The Water in 霖 perfectly supports the Wood Dragon year, while balancing our family's Fire elements

**4. Phonetic Analysis:**
- Tone progression: 1-4-2
- Flow assessment: The flow from first tone to fourth to second creates a pleasing rhythm
- Dialectal considerations: Consistent pronunciation across Mandarin, Cantonese, and Hakka dialects
- Potential pronunciation issues: None identified; "Lin" works internationally and is easily pronounced across cultures

**5. Cultural Safety Check:**
- Historical figure conflicts: No significant namesakes in Chinese history
- Modern figure conflicts: No notable contemporary figures with this name
- Regional meaning checks: Positive associations across mainland China and Southeast Asian Chinese communities
- Dialect meaning checks: No negative homonyms in major Chinese dialects
- Homonym analysis: No concerning sound-alike words

**6. Meaning Depth:**
- Individual character significance: 
  - 旭 represents new beginnings, rising energy, and the morning sun
  - 霖 symbolizes timely blessing, nurturing rain, and continuous abundance
- Combined imagery: A sunrise bringing beneficial rain—balanced energy of growth and nurturing
- Literary references: 霖 appears in classical texts referring to timely rain that nourishes crops
- Cultural connotations: Suggests balanced dynamism—both energizing and nurturing
- Gender appropriateness: Suitable for a boy, combining strength with nurturing qualities

**7. Name Flexibility:**
- Formal/informal usage: Works well in both professional and personal contexts
- International considerations: Both characters translate well conceptually; "Lin" is easily pronounced globally
- Nickname potential: "Lin" forms a natural nickname
- Writing style variations: Both characters maintain integrity across different calligraphy styles

**8. Overall Assessment:**
- Strengths:
  - Perfect elemental balance for Wood Dragon year
  - Beautiful meaning combining energy with nurturing
  - Excellent visual balance between simple and complex characters
  - International adaptability
  - Strong cultural associations without being overly common
- Concerns:
  - Contrast in stroke count between middle and last character is significant
  - May require explanation of meaning to non-Chinese speakers

- Recommendation Rating: 9/10

While these systematic steps might make the process sound mechanical, the experience was anything but. Each AI-generated suggestion sparked conversations between my wife and me about our values, our cultural identities, and our hopes for our child. The technology may have provided the framework, but the journey was deeply personal and emotionally resonant.

The human touch

While AI proved remarkably helpful in analysing and generating options, the final decision remained deeply human. AI could tell us that 萧旭霖 (Xiāo Xùlín) had “perfect elemental balance for Wood Dragon year” and “beautiful meaning of supportive abundance,” but it couldn’t tell us which name felt right when spoken aloud.

Some insights from our process:

  1. AI excels at systematic analysis – It can process thousands of character combinations against multiple criteria in seconds, something even the most knowledgeable human naming expert would find daunting.
  2. Cultural nuance requires human oversight – While AI understands rules and references, the subtleties of cultural significance still benefit from human intuition and experience.
  3. Emotional resonance remains human territory – The feeling when you say a name and think “that’s the one”—that magical moment belongs to humans alone.
  4. AI reduces bias and expands possibilities – It suggests combinations a human might not consider, freeing parents from being limited by personal preference or familiarity.

Final decision

Since we were choosing the names before the baby was born, we didn’t have the baby’s bazi that required the time of birth to derive. Thus, we got the AI to do another round of checks against our shortlist when we had the baby’s bazi.

Based on the baby’s bazi, we could determine what elements are lacking and balance accordingly with the name. For example, if the time of birth already has Fire, we would avoid names with Fire and prefer names with Water.

I actually planned for this by getting the AI to come up with options that are more versatile in balancing, and variations that would preserve the sound and stroke counts while changing the element through switching radicals.

It’s illegal for healthcare professionals to reveal the baby’s gender during birth in China, so our shortlist included both masculine and feminine names.

Beyond Chinese names

The parallels between Eastern and Western naming considerations are striking once you look closely. Where Chinese parents might worry about stroke counts and elemental balance, Western parents often fret about name popularity rankings and family traditions.

Both approaches seek to provide children with names that carry positive associations and set them up for success—just through different cultural lenses. AI can help bridge these approaches by analysing names through multiple cultural frameworks simultaneously.

Even if you’re not naming a child in Chinese, the AI-assisted approach offers valuable lessons:

  • Comprehensive analysis: Consider multiple dimensions of a name beyond just how it sounds
  • Cultural verification: Check for unintended meanings or associations across cultures
  • Future adaptability: Think about how the name will work in different contexts throughout life
  • Meaning layers: Look for depth and resonance that grows with your child

For Western names, AI can help check popularity trends, cultural associations, nickname potential, and even how the name pairs with siblings’ names—all factors that contribute to finding that perfect match.

Balancing tradition & technology

What fascinates me most about this process is how it represents the bridge between ancient traditions and cutting-edge technology. Chinese naming practices date back thousands of years, yet here we are using neural networks to carry those traditions forward.

It’s a reminder that technology works best not when it replaces human culture, but when it helps preserve and enhance it. The AI doesn’t choose the name—it simply helps parents navigate the complex considerations with greater confidence and insight.

In a way, this approach mirrors my own journey of straddling cultural worlds. Just as I find harmony between East and West, traditional and modern, the AI-assisted naming process finds balance between age-old wisdom and contemporary tools.

Final thoughts

Choosing a name remains one of the most personal decisions parents make. It’s a gift of identity, a first legacy given to a child before they’ve even taken their first breath. While AI can inform this process, the magic still happens in the hearts of those who will whisper that name with love for decades to come.

When we finally settled on Yifei, there was a moment of shared clarity between my wife and I. The name simply felt right in a way that’s difficult to articulate—a feeling AI could never replicate. When we shared it with our families, they expressed a liking for the name, aside from the concerns about the complex stroke count. The blend of old wisdom and new technology seemed to bridge generational gaps in an unexpected way.

If you’re expecting and considering how to approach naming, remember that AI can be a helpful guide on your journey—but the final choice belongs to your heart alone.

Don't miss a post

Join 1000+ others and get new posts delivered to your inbox.

I hate spam and won't send you any.